Deploy Plesk on Your Server
Getting started with Plesk involves several simple steps to configure your server for hosting websites. First, you'll need to verify that your server meets the minimum system requirements. Then, download the newest version of Plesk from the official website and follow the detailed instructions provided. During installation, you'll have the option to adjust settings like the server domain name, email accounts, and database configuration. Once installation is complete, you can access to Plesk's control panel through a web browser using your credentials.
From there, you can oversee your websites, domains, email accounts, and other server resources with ease. Keep in mind that regular updates are crucial for maintaining the security and stability of your Plesk environment.

Troubleshooting Common Plesk Installation Difficulties
Plesk, a popular web hosting control panel, can sometimes present challenges during the setup process. Common issues include MySQL server conflicts, incorrect access, or configuration problems. First, it's crucial to check the Plesk installation documentation and recommendations provided by SW-Soft.
